springsecurity的認證授權有兩種方式:基於session和基於token。由於token的使用會比較多,下面講token的這種方式。 整個大概的流程是這樣的: 1.用戶訪問服務器進行登錄,服務器返回登錄頁面給用戶 2.用戶填寫用戶名和密碼,並提交給服務 ...
使用SpringSecurity搭建授權認證服務 基本demo 登錄認證是做后台開發的最基本的能力,初學就知道一個interceptor或者filter攔截所有請求,然后判斷參數是否合理,如此即可。當涉及到某些接口權限的時候,則if else判斷以下,也是沒問題的。 但如果判斷多了,業務邏輯也摻雜在一起,降低可讀性的同時也不利於擴展和維護。於是就出現了apache shiro, spring se ...
2019-07-09 11:40 0 1362 推薦指數:
springsecurity的認證授權有兩種方式:基於session和基於token。由於token的使用會比較多,下面講token的這種方式。 整個大概的流程是這樣的: 1.用戶訪問服務器進行登錄,服務器返回登錄頁面給用戶 2.用戶填寫用戶名和密碼,並提交給服務 ...
1.引入依賴 2.編寫相應的配置類 ...
SpringBoot--- 使用SpringSecurity進行授權認證 前言 在未接觸 SpringSecurity 、Shiro 等安全認證框架之前,如果有頁面權限需求需要滿足,通常可以用攔截器,過濾器來實現。 但是,這需要大量配置類去完成,代碼編寫工作量是巨大的。為提高工作效率,學習 ...
認證+授權代碼實現 Spring Security是 一種基於 Spring AOP 和 Servlet 過濾器的安全框架。它提供全面的安全性解決方案,同時在 Web 請求級和方法調用級處理身份確認和授權。 有關認證和授權的理論知識,之前有寫過相關博客。了解權限管理 ...
認證和授權學習6:前后端分離狀態下使用springsecurity 本文使用的springboot版本是2.1.3.RELEASE 目錄 認證和授權學習6:前后端分離狀態下使用springsecurity 一、簡要描述 二、配置 ...
什么是OAuth授權? 一、什么是OAuth協議 OAuth(開放授權)是一個開放標准。 允許第三方網站在用戶授權的前提下訪問在用戶在服務商那里存儲的各種信息。 而這種授權無需將用戶提供用戶名和密碼提供給該第三方網站 ...
認證和授權。根據現實案例,前后端分離,並且后端為分布式部署。解決redis session共享方式的跨 ...
主要用到了springboot,springsecurity,mybatis,jsp 1. 創建項目 使用idea中的spring工具創建項目創建時勾選springboot start web和springsecurity最終生成的pom.xml文件如下 2. 數據庫表字段信息 ...